Joshua Safdie [1] (born April 3, 1984) [2] and Benjamin Safdie [1] (born February 24, 1986) [3] are independent American filmmakers and actors based in New York City, who frequently collaborate on their films. They are best known for writing and directing the crime thriller films Good Time (2017), starring Robert Pattinson, and ...
